簡化您的 Magento 2 升級:需要遵循的 10 個最佳實踐
已發表: 2023-10-03各種規模的企業都應優先升級至 Magento 2 (Adobe Commerce),這是最受歡迎的電子商務平台的最新版本。 隨時了解最新功能和安全修補程式對於獲得最佳電子商務體驗至關重要。 儘管升級 Magento 2 的過程可能具有挑戰性,但遵循最佳實踐將顯著降低升級過程中可能發生的停機、資料遺失和其他問題的可能性。
為什麼企業需要從 Magento 1 升級到 Magento 2?
升級 Magento 2 擁有改進的性能,超越了其前身 Magento 1。儘管 Magento 1 的功能仍然存在,但升級到 Magento 2 提供了許多優勢。 以下是從 Magento 1 升級到 Magento 2 的一些好處:
擴充功能
Magento 2 提供了大量的先進功能來幫助 B2B 運作。 它有助於企業配置定價和付款設定以及設定客戶帳戶和報價。 此外,它還促進更簡單的結帳、訂單管理和增加客戶細分。
更好的使用者體驗和安全性
相較於Magento 1,Magento 2的使用者體驗顯著提升。 它採用針對行動裝置進行最佳化的現代直覺設計,使客戶能夠快速且安全地找到所需的商品並完成交易。 此外,該平台的高級加密和身份驗證功能以及整合的惡意軟體和病毒防護可確保您的網站免受惡意攻擊。
更好的支持
如果您在使用 Magento 2 時遇到任何技術問題,您可以向經驗豐富的專業人員尋求支援。 這種有用的幫助將節省您的時間和金錢。 相比之下,對於仍在使用 Magento 1 的人來說,則無法獲得此類幫助。
Magento 2 順利升級的 10 個最佳實踐
對於許多電子商務 B2B 企業來說,過渡到 Magento 2 至關重要。 必須採取最佳實踐以確保流程取得成功。 以下是從 Magento 1 升級到 Magento 2 時需要遵循的一些做法。
1. 提前規劃
在開始 Magento 2 升級之前製定精心製定的計劃至關重要。 該計劃必須為整個升級過程提供時間表和明確的指導方針。 如果您僱用 Magento 開發人員,請確保他們理解您的目標以及他們要遵守的時間表。 您的計劃必須包含產品目錄、使用者資訊和商店配置參數。
2.評估您目前的數據
在開始升級過程之前,請花時間檢查現有資料。 在此過程中,確定哪些組件是成功的、哪些組件需要改進以及哪些組件需要更改。
3. 備份
在 Magento 升級服務之前採取預防措施是必要的,方法是建立商店資料和檔案(包括資料庫、媒體和程式碼)的備份。 這樣,如果升級過程中出現問題,您可以快速將網站恢復到原始狀態。
4、相容性
在升級 Magento 2 之前,請驗證所有外部擴充功能、主題和個人化程式碼是否相容。 過時的擴充功能可能會引發相容性問題,並使您的網站在升級後無法正常運作。
5.審查變更日誌
Magento 2 (Adobe Commerce) 的最新版本提供了許多變更和改進,例如對程式碼、資料庫和檔案結構的變更。 謹慎的做法是查看變更日誌,以了解實施了哪些變更和更新,以便為這些變更可能對網站產生的任何影響做好準備。
6.更新擴充
確保您的所有擴充功能和插件均已更新。 過時或不相容的附加元件可能會阻礙升級後線上商店的正常運作。 除此之外,新的擴充旨在最大限度地利用 Magento 2 (Adobe Commerce) 的新功能和功能。 安全性修補程式會定期應用於這些外掛程式和擴展,以確保您的網站免受潛在攻擊。 透過讓您的擴充功能和外掛程式保持最新,您將受益於 Magento 2 的新功能和功能。
7.進行程式碼審查
進行程式碼審查以保護您的網站免受潛在威脅並確保您的自訂程式碼針對最新版本的 Magento 2 進行最佳化至關重要。此過程需要檢查所有自訂模組、外掛程式和主題修改以確定如果有任何程式碼需要更新。 為 Magento 2 早期版本建立的自訂程式碼可能不適合最近的迭代,因此此審查可以幫助避免相容性問題。
8. 清理數據
隨著您的 Magento 2 設定老化,它可能會因過多、過時或無關的數據而陷入困境,這些數據可能會影響您網站的速度和響應能力。 不需要的記錄可以縮短升級過程的持續時間並最大限度地降低資料損壞的風險。
採取主動措施清理資料還可以增強安全性,因為這可以減少網站的攻擊面並防止機密資料或客戶詳細資訊的潛在洩漏。 消除不必要的資訊有助於保護系統的完整性。
9. 測試升級
在將升級整合到您的即時網站之前,請在臨時環境中進行測試運行。 這樣,您可以在任何可能的差異影響您的電子商務網站之前檢測並修改它們。 然後,仔細檢查 Magento 升級服務是否正確完成以及所有功能是否正常運作。 在單獨的環境中進行測試可以避免您將來出現停機和資料遺失,同時確保一切正常運作。
10.監控升級
密切觀察升級進度,確保一切有效率運作。 檢查日誌中是否有問題或錯誤,並確保所有功能正常運作。 此外,評估您網站的效能。 如果您遇到任何問題,請迅速解決,以防止任何可能的停機或資料遺失,從而確保升級成功。 採取這些步驟將有助於確保平穩過渡並最大限度地減少任何潛在的干擾。
結束語
為了確保您的 Adobe Commerce 升級按計劃進行,請備份您的網站、提前規劃、測試升級並遵守最佳實踐。 如果不這樣做,可能會導致資料遺失、相容性問題和其他困難,從而影響網站的效能和效率。 聘請來自印度的 Magento 開發人員並遵守這些最佳實踐; 您的升級應該會順利進行。